Transaction e307b3cd6d24acd8fdbc9221c89f388a8374399d4ea38123017de0504048d634

block
4d875931e1dd2589f0f409d7c7885976eaf4c826ff941afc27cf10f1ad7b063c

150 Inputs

1 Output